Emotional Intelligence Keeps Our Remote Clients Actively Engaged

April 2022 Bar Bulletin

By Elise Buie

I founded my fully-remote law firm, devoted to family and estate planning, long before the pandemic sent us all to our home offices.1 The moment I made this strategic decision, driven initially by my desire to work full time while spending after-school hours with my young family, I knew I would need to get creative. If I wanted to engage actively — and stay engaged — with our clients, that is.

Unfortunately, given that remote work wasn’t commonplace in non-pandemic times yet, I didn’t have anyone’s footsteps to follow, no roadmap to reference, and little idea about where to start. But I did...
